Waiting Moms



We had a wonderful gathering of DFW families at our house last night. We ate some Ethiopian food, made new friends, and the kids had a blast! It was a wonderful night of encouragement! After we took the above picture of Moms, most of who are waiting to bring their child(ren) home, I really spent time thinking about and praying for the Moms waiting in Ethiopia....


These precious mothers are waiting for their prayers for their children to be answered, waiting for the Lord to respond to their cries for help. During my waiting process one of my constant prayers has been for the family our children have in Ethiopia. I do not know yet if they have been with their family recently or have been in an orphanage. But I have continued to ask the Lord to give these precious children as much time as possible with their family, as many moments as possible with their mother. I never asked the Lord to rush that time...even on these days when I long to hear news of a referral and I long for our children to join our family! While my heart already says I love these children as a mother....I know they will always have two mothers....and my prayers will always be with their family and people in Ethiopia.


So as we continue to wait....I continue to pray as for the Moms in Ethiopia that wait on the Lord too...



Yet those who wait for the Lord will gain new strength; They will mount up with wings like eagles, They will run and not get tired, They will walk and not become weary. Isaiah 40:31
